Motif du rappel / Danger

A seat that fails may not properly restrain an occupant during a crash, increasing risk of injury.

Description du produit & Identification

Orange EV (OEV) is recalling certain 2022-2023 T-Series Pure Electric Terminal Trucks, 2023-2025 e-TRIEVER, and 2023-2026 HUSK-e terminal trucks. The optional foldaway training seat may fail.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ard numbers 207, "Seating Systems" and 210, Seat Belt Assembly Anchorages."

Corrective actionOwners are advised to limit the use of the the training seat until repairs have been completed. The remedy is currently under development. Interim owner notification letters are expected to be mailed by April 24, 2026. Another notice will be sent once the remedy becomes available. Owners may contact OEV customer service at 1-866-688-5223. OEV's number for this recall is 2026-SRC-02.
